Natasha Scott, PhD, is an accomplished professional with extensive experience in organizational psychology and safety culture. Currently serving as a Senior Specialist with the Office of the Superintendent of Financial Institutions Canada since February 2020, Natasha has held various senior roles, including Senior Risk Specialist. Prior experience includes serving as a Human and Organizational Factors Specialist at the National Energy Board, where responsibilities entailed regulatory oversight of safety culture and organizational dynamics. Natasha has also acted as Director of Research & Innovation, leading teams in performance improvement strategies. Previous roles include Senior Advisor at Pascal Metrics, where Natasha provided expertise in survey design and organizational culture, and as an Organizational Psychology Consultant, delivering assessments and training across various sectors. Natasha holds a PhD and a Master of Science in Industrial and Organizational Psychology from Saint Mary’s University, where also served as part-time faculty.
